    I would say that it's not very wise to pump shards into the shrine for BP. Especially since it takes considerably longer to get that many shards in comparison to how long it would take to get 150K BP. The shards would probably be better spent on original characters. Even if you currently have them all now, saving shards still may mean you don't need to spend any money the next time there's a new original chapter. Do what you want though.

    It your preference. I personally have nothing to buy with shards. Every outfit I want has been bought, I keep auric cells in stock for new ones I like. The one thing you can't buy in this game is BP and it's what is needed most. If you want to save up 20k shards for a outfit that your call but I have only bough one cosmetic for shards (7000 shard oni skin) and I have regretted it ever since. If you still have characters to unlock and can buy with shards that can be a smart play. All up to you and where you are in the game.
